The Mountain (Al-Toor)
In the name of God, the Most Gracious, the Most Merciful
By the Mount (of Revelation); 1 And the Scripture inscribed 2 in an exposed parchment 3 And the House frequented, 4 By the Canopy Raised High; 5 And the swollen sea, 6 the punishment of your Lord shall certainly come to pass, 7 There is none who could avert it. 8 On the day when the heaven will heave with (awful) heaving, 9 And the mountains will move away with an awful movement. 10 Woe will be to those who rejected the Truth 11 Who play in talk of grave matters; 12 on that Day they shall be ruthlessly thrust into the Fire of Hell. 13 This is the fire which you used to deny. 14 Is it magic then or do you not see? 15 Burn in its heat. It is all the same for you whether you exercise patience or not; This is the recompense for your deeds". 16 Surely those who guard (against evil) shall be in gardens and bliss 17 Rejoicing in that which their Lord hath vouchsafed unto them; and their Lord will protect them from the torment of the Flame. 18 [They will be told], "Eat and drink in satisfaction for what you used to do." 19 Reclining on ranged couches. And we wed them unto fair ones with wide, lovely eyes. 20 The offspring of the believers will also follow them to Paradise. So shall We join their offspring to them because of their faith. We shall reduce nothing from their deeds. Everyone will be responsible for his own actions. 21 We shall provide them with fruits and the meat of the kind which they desire. 22 They will exchange with one another a cup [of wine] wherein [results] no ill speech or commission of sin. 23 ۞ And there go round, waiting on them menservants of their own, as they were hidden pearls. 24 They will go to one another asking each other questions: 25 They say, 'We were before among our people, ever going in fear, 26 “So Allah did us a great favour, and saved us from the punishment of the flame.” 27 before this, we used to pray to Him. Surely, He is the Beneficent, the Merciful." 28
